Mullally joins Whitehaven on loan deal
Widnes Vikings Friday 8 Jun 2012 3:04pm
Vikings prop forward Anthony Mullally has today joined Whitehaven on a loan deal for the remainder of the 2012 Co-operative Championship One season.
20 year-old Mullally has made 9 substitute appearances for the Vikings thus far in 2012, and if selected by Head Coach Don Gailer, is set to have an immediate opportunity to impress for his new team who face South Wales Scorpions at the Recreation Ground on Sunday afternoon.
Vikings Director of Rugby, Paul Cullen said; "The loan process is a system that benefits both parties. Whitehaven's squad will be boosted by the arrival of a quality player, while Anthony will gain valuable experience playing week in week out in a tough environment. Having seen his opportunities limited in recent times, this will certainly aid his development as a player."
Whitehaven Chief Executive, Barry Richardson added; "We are extremely grateful to Widnes Vikings Rugby League Club and Paul Cullen for allowing Anthony to join us for the remainder of the season. Having seen him play and received so many good reports about him, we are absolutely delighted to capture the services of such a quality player and are hopeful his introduction will give us a huge push in our bid for promotion this year."
